About the Lovell Lab

The lab is located in the University at Buffalo's Biomedical Engineering department. We focus on designing and developing innovative nanomedicine solutions to address unmet clinical needs in diagnostics and therapy. Our research integrates engineering principles to design, synthesize, characterize, test, and validate next-generation nanoparticles and biosensors aimed at improving human health.

A major thrust of the lab is developing safer organic nanoparticles that offer improved treatment options for cancer.
